This October 4th, two builders introduced the BIP-447. Comfortable fork (Comfortable branching), a change within the guidelines that nodes can undertake with out fragmenting the community.
Title: “Selection discount of block area for transactions utilizing Poda + any knowledge in Op_return with out breaking the revalidation of Merkle Tree,” BIP-447 offers with using registrationas knowledge equivalent to textual content and pictures is embedded in Bitcoin by way of op_return. That is the code that provides non-sales data to a transaction.
As reported by Cryptootics, operations with op_return It has been linked to the current «Buyer Battle »displays the tensions between the assorted approaches that the authors of BIP-447 take into account to be problematic.
- In the meantime, Luke Dashul launched it on Bitcoin Knot. Filtered by patterns to dam transactions with inscriptions. As learn within the BIP-447 repository, this filtering encourages customers to keep away from P2P (individual to individual) networks, ship transactions on to giant swimming pools, and focus mining energy on these platforms.
- The opposite was proposed within the subsequent model of this shopper, Bitcoin Core V.30, which shall be introduced this month. Unlawful content material Like youngster pornwhich might trigger issues.
How does BIP-447 work with Bitcoin?
The BIP-447 textual content particulars its operation at three necessary factors:
First, he factors out Calm down transaction registration by way of a Comfortable fork It’s going to improve the price of The script is complemented (Applications that carry out actions) With out growing the capability of the block.
If specified, Comfortable fork It causes them The inscription of op_return takes 4 instances That is at the moment.
This case workout routines financial strain on what the writer understands as “abuse of blockchain” and maintains commonplace buying and selling effectivity.
As detailed, new nodes use OP_Returns which might be higher than 32 bytes to assign giant weights to transactions, however in addition they respect the digital weight restrict of as much as 4 megabytes established by Segwit, which can be conscious of historical nodes.
It’s going to guarantee blocks Efficient for all and keep consensus of the community.
Second, BIP-447 follows a deployment mannequin often called “UASF” (Comfortable Person Activation). Implement these guidelines with out counting on developer teams They have not solved the issue.
In such a approach, this UASF provides the node the power to make particular person selections Buyer coverage apart.
Third, we’ll combine segidata pudable storage choicessegwit (separate validation knowledge and separate areas), nodes can retailer solely the necessary elements of the transaction, discard the remaining, and relieve the load.
This integration gives node operators Financial safety by decreasing {hardware} prices and authorized safety By avoiding storing problematic content material.
What are the important thing factors to enhance BIP-447 with Bitcoin?
Among the many facets that the proposal guarantees enchancment are:
- Cut back the load on the write node and permit you to see transactions With out preserving the whole UTXO state (non-depent transaction output). This makes it simpler to entry.
- Cut back bandwidth consumption by sending supplemental knowledge as wanted; Visitors Optimization.
- It promotes gradual scalability that enables networks to adapt to nodes of various capabilities with out sacrificing safety. Moreover, by decreasing the working prices of such highly effective nodes, We encourage extra members to govern themStrengthening decentralization.
To discourage extreme use of area in bitcoin recordsdata, the op_return output exceeds 32 bytes They’ll face 4 instancesEliminates weight reductions that may embody as much as 4 MB in a 1MB area, like Segwit.
In distinction, a 32-byte secdata dedication doesn’t incur this extra penalty. Its design avoids weight acquire utilized to giant knowledge and permits nodes to handle them. With out punishing the area busy.
The scheme creates financial strain on customers Depart a heavy inscription Alternatively, transfer to a printing format equivalent to segdata.
You may see it in a digital instance contributed by the proposed writer.
Based on your doc, The financial influence of BIP-447 is necessary. “A 1 MB inscription reduces 4 to 1 (75% much less) per block, and 100 kb inscriptions from 40 to 10 (75% much less)”.
These modifications, based on the textual content, make the inscription too costly to proceed utilizing them indiscriminately.
The proposed writer reveals how the price of a Bitcoin transaction modifications dramatically relying on the kind on the worth of 20 atshis (sat/vb) per digital byte.
For instance, a easy operation prices round 2,800 Satosh (roughly $2.80 for $124,000 BTC) and a Multifilma 2-DE-3 (Multisig) It’s going to rise to roughly 3,200 Satoshu ($3.20).
Nonetheless, for those who register for 1 MB, the worth is I shoot as much as 20,000,000 Satoshu (approx. $20,000)4 instances the present 5,000,000 coal ($5,000).

